[0001] This invention relates to the field of polylactic acid foam materials technology, and in particular to a method for preparing polylactic acid microporous injection foam materials. Background Technology

[0002] Among biodegradable materials, polylactic acid (PLA) is a biodegradable plastic with physical and mechanical properties closest to polyolefins, and it can be manufactured on a large scale for commercial use. With increasing environmental awareness and the demand for sustainable development, PLA, as a biodegradable green polymer material, is increasingly widely used in packaging, medical, automotive, and home furnishing fields. Foaming technology can further reduce the density of PLA materials, improve their cushioning and thermal insulation properties, and meet more application needs. However, the high price and relatively high density of PLA products limit their application range. Furthermore, the low melt strength and slow crystallization rate of PLA limit its foaming performance. Therefore, when preparing PLA foam materials, PLA needs to be modified to improve its melt strength and crystallization properties. PLA foaming methods are generally divided into physical foaming and chemical foaming. Physical foaming uses supercritical CO2 or N2 as a foaming agent, employing a method of rapid pressure reduction and temperature increase to allow the gaseous foaming agent to nucleate and grow inside the PLA. Chemical foaming, on the other hand, uses a foaming agent to generate bubbles through a chemical reaction. Highly efficient injection molding methods allow for the production of polylactic acid (PLA) products of various sizes and shapes. While maintaining environmental friendliness and mechanical properties, this process achieves lightweighting and cost reduction, leading to a wide range of applications. PLA microporous injection-molded foam materials are characterized by their light weight, high strength, good thermal insulation, and excellent cushioning properties, making them promising for applications in packaging materials, automotive interiors, building insulation, and biomedicine. With continuous technological advancements and cost reductions, the application areas of PLA microporous injection-molded foam materials will continue to expand. Summary of the Invention

[0003] To achieve the above objectives, this invention provides a method for preparing polylactic acid microporous injection foam material and the same method.

[0004] In a first aspect, the present invention provides a method for preparing a polylactic acid microporous injection foam material, comprising the following steps:

[0005] Step S1: Add PBS matrix, nucleating agent, foaming agent, zinc oxide and PDMS into a mixer and mix at a temperature of 100-105℃, a speed of 45-50 rpm and a time of 10-15 min. Then granulate to obtain GAC.

[0006] Step S2: Add chain extender, crosslinking agent, antioxidant, and white oil to LX530 and mix to obtain a mixture. Extrude and granulate using a twin-screw extruder with an aspect ratio of less than 35. The feed port temperature is 150-160℃, the melt zone temperature is 170-180℃, the homogenization zone temperature is 185-190℃, the die temperature is 180-185℃, the screw speed is 180-200 rpm, and the feed motor operating frequency is 6.5-8.5 Hz. After extrusion, place the mixture in a forced-air drying oven at 75℃ for 6 hours to obtain PLAAU.

[0007] Further, by weight, step S1 contains 3-6 parts PBS base, 4-7 parts foaming agent, 1-3 parts nucleating agent TMC-300, 0.3-0.5 parts PDMS and 0.02-0.06 parts zinc oxide.

[0008] Furthermore, by weight, 0.02-0.3 parts of chain extender, 0.01-0.4 parts of crosslinking agent, 0.01-0.04 parts of plasticizer and 0.01-0.04 parts of antioxidant are contained in step S2.

[0009] Furthermore, the PBS matrix mentioned in step S1 is Shandong Xuke 118; the foaming agent is Hangzhou Greenbee HH74; and the PDMS is Hubei Yamaide 9006-65-9 with a viscosity of 750 CP.

[0010] Furthermore, the chain extender mentioned in step S2 is BASF ADR-4468 or BASF AS-K25, the crosslinking agent is Dongguan Haosheng UN3106, the antioxidant is BASF 1010 or BASF B225, and the plasticizer is Suzhou Hesen 10# white oil.

[0011] Furthermore, in step S1, the process settings for the mixer are 100°C, 50 rpm, and 10 min.

[0012] Furthermore, in step S2, the feed port temperature of the twin-screw extruder is 150℃, the melting zone temperature is 170℃-180℃, the homogenization zone temperature is 185℃, the die temperature is 180℃, and the screw speed is 180-200 rpm.

[0013] Furthermore, in step S2, the operating frequency of the feeding motor is 6.5-8.5Hz, and the extruded material in step S2 needs to be dried at 75℃ for 6 hours in a forced-air drying oven.

[0014] Furthermore, the weight ratio of PLAAU and GAC in step S3 is 100:3.

[0015] This invention relates to a method for preparing polylactic acid (PLA) microporous injection foam material. The PLA microporous injection foam material prepared has internal pore sizes of 50µm-75µm and a pore density of 1.5*10⁻⁶. 6 cells / cm 3 -4.5*10 6 cells / cm 3 .

[0017] 1. Due to the low melt strength of polylactic acid (PLA), direct foaming processes can easily cause internal cell rupture in related products. This invention modifies PLA by blending a fixed amount of foaming agent masterbatch with the modified PLA into an unmodified injection molding machine. A lower injection pressure, a faster injection speed, and a higher holding pressure are used, with the injection temperature gradient from high to low from the feeding point to the nozzle. The injection speed is around 80%, the holding time is maintained at around 2 seconds, and the entire injection time is controlled at around 20 seconds. This allows for the efficient preparation of PLA microporous injection foam materials. Attached Figure Description

[0024] Example 1

[0025] This embodiment provides a polylactic acid injection foam product, the preparation method of which specifically includes the following steps:

[0026] Step S1: Add 5.597 parts of PBS118, 1 part of TMC-300 from Shanxi Chemical Research Institute, 3 parts of HH74, 0.03 parts of zinc oxide and 0.4 parts of PDMS into a mixer. Set the process temperature to 100℃ and the rotation speed to 50 rpm. Mix for 10 min and then pelletize to obtain GAC.

[0027] Step S2: Add 0.2 parts AS-K25, 0.02 parts UN3106, 0.02 parts B225 and 0.03 parts white oil to 9.1 parts LX530 and mix to obtain a mixture. Take 10 parts of the mixture and put it into a high-speed mixer for mixing. Then put it into a twin-screw extruder with the feed port temperature at 150℃, the melting zone temperature at 175℃, the homogenization zone temperature at 185℃, the die temperature at 180℃, the screw speed at 200rpm, and the operating frequency of the feed motor at 8Hz. After extrusion, place it in a forced-air drying oven at 75℃ for 6 hours to obtain PLAAU1.

[0028] Step S3: Mix 100 parts PLAAU1 and 3 parts GAC and add them to the hopper of the injection molding machine to prepare the injection molded part. The injection temperature is 175°C, the injection pressure is 60 bar, the injection speed is 80%, the holding pressure is 80 bar, and the holding speed is 90%.

[0029] The liquid nitrogen embrittlement fracture surface of the injection molded part prepared in Example 1 was scanned by SEM. The results are shown in the figure. Figure 1 It can be seen that the bubbles are evenly distributed, uniformly mixed, and relatively consistent in size, indicating a good foaming effect. The dumbbell shape indicates that the cracks are hindered during the expansion process, and the stress is relatively strong.

[0046] Comparison of chain extender types: PLAAU1 changed from a multifunctional chain extender to an epoxy cyclic chain extender, which to some extent increased the compatibility of PLA and PBS, and the melt strength improvement effect was also more obvious.

[0063] As shown in Table 3, when the amount of foaming agent added is too large, the gas cannot be fully dissolved and diffused, the formation of cells is not restricted, and the mechanical properties of the product are greatly affected. From the weight loss data of the DBL samples, it can be seen that the weight loss of Example 1 is smaller than that of Comparative Examples 3-5, and the weight loss of Example 2 is smaller than that of Comparative Examples 6-8.
